Shell: Blows away the winchester, and clear BE hopper. The casing is made of what the 150rd hopper is made, I tossed it around dropped it loaded with crappy paint even had Reagan run around the yard with it, it held up with no cracks. It's basically a sightfeeder just 1/3 the size.

Lid: No spring, a basic flip lid made of similar if not the same material the atomic elbows are made of. Has two beads holding the hopper lid in place. Am I worried about that? A little bit..a direct hit I do not see it cracking. I opened and closed it, slammed it shut, etc and nothing broke. Field tests will need to confirm it. Either way it has a life time guarantee with it, I think that makes up for it.

Feeding: 1 jam due to an oval ball, I loaded 50 round ones and got no jams.

Size: I love it personally, it can be a main hopper and also a pocket hopper.

Price point: Much better than todays PMI sportshots, it's affordable, life time guarantee and proudly made in the USA.

Rating: 9/10 I believe APP finally opened their eyes with in my opinion the failure of the other 50rd hopper. I see these being marketed with Tippmanns SL series for future sales.
